Does diet matter in gout? What should I eat or not eat?

Does diet matter in gout? What should I eat or not eat?

In severe gout, dietary changes are usually not enough to prevent repeated attacks, and medications are needed to lower the uric acid. However, if you are not taking medication for your gout, and even if you are, it is reasonable to limit your intake of foods high in purines. For the first six months after starting allopurinol for gout, your diet is especially important in helping to prevent attacks.
